If you have attempted to turn on your phone, but it just will not turn on, you may be wondering just what is going on. If the phone is charged, the problem is likely due to something else going on. Below, we will discuss some of the different reasons why your iPhone may not be turning on even though it is fully charged.  Bad Battery or Charging Port  A bad battery or charging port can lead to your phone not turning on due to a poor charge. While you may think the phone is fully charged, if you have a bad battery or charging port, it may not be at all or it may have a very weak charge. Your phone requires a certain amount of battery to be able to turn on, so if it does not have it, it cannot turn on.  One way to fix the issue is to look inside the charging port to see if it has been damaged or see if it is broken or loose. If it is, you will need to have it replaced. If not, you should try to replace the battery to see if that fixes the issue.  Bad Power Button  Your phone may not be turning on because the power button is bad. This can happen from time to time and when you press it down, there may not be a connection for it to turn on. One way to test this is to plug your device into a different power supply and then power the phone on. If it turns on, it is not the power button. If it does not turn on, then it may be the power button.  Bad Display  If you cannot see anything appearing on your screen when you turn it on, you may think the phone is not turning on, but it could be. In fact, if the display is bad, the screen may very well be on and you just cannot see anything. To test this, listen for sound on the device. If you can hear sound, then the display is bad.  Restart Required  Your phone may be in need of a forced restart. If there is a software issue with the iOS or if an app is not working correctly, it can cause issues. The best way to see if a forced restart will work is to try it. If your phone turns on after the restart and you can see the screen, then that is all that was needed. If it does not, then the problem may be more complicated.  Bad Logic Board  A phone relies on its motherboard (logic board) to operate and when issues arise with the board, the phone reacts to that. A damaged or faulty board can cause your phone not to turn on, even when it is charged. Some other issues you may experience include problems with the dot project or face ID.
